Standard Kitchen Sink Window Height

How High Should a Kitchen Sink Window Be?

The height of your kitchen sink window will ultimately depend on your personal preferences and the layout of your kitchen. However, there are some general guidelines that can help you determine the best height for your kitchen sink window. Typically, the bottom of the window should be around 6 inches above the top of your sink, allowing for easy access to open and close the window while also providing enough space for a backsplash.

Measuring Kitchen Sink Window Height

When measuring the height of your kitchen sink window, it's important to take into account the size of your sink and the height of your countertops. Measure from the floor to the top of your sink, and then add an additional 6 inches to determine the bottom of the window. This will allow for easy access to open and close the window while also providing enough space for a backsplash.
